Ticket: Ledgerpeek audit-log viewer drops entries when you filter by actor and then paginate past page 3. Looks like the cursor ignores the filter and skips ahead. Not data loss — the rows are still in storage — but it spooks auditors. Flagging for the weekly sync; the regression first appears in the build noted below.

session token of tajef-bageg = htk21_5d90d574934f3ccae6437

When the Fanwell notifier queue depth exceeds 50k, the fan-out workers begin shedding low-priority pushes. Scale the worker pool to 12 replicas before adjusting retry intervals, otherwise the backlog re-inflates within minutes. Watch the drain rate on the Pellgrove dashboard until it stabilizes under 2k/min. After scaling, the workers must re-authenticate against the dispatch broker, so update the env file on each host. Add the broker signing secret on the next line.

vault entry, kagep-yajeg: COURIER_KEY5=da097

Subject: DR drill — Pipelark deploy-status bot

As part of Thursday's disaster-recovery drill, we will fail over Pipelark, the chat bot that reports deploy status, to the Ostbridge standby cluster. No production deploys are affected. For your security review, the restore procedure requires the operator to enter the standby vault's recovery passphrase, reproduced below for the drill record.

recovery phrase for yawig-kajog: casox-prair-holax-quenix-fraael-belath-casath

Runbook: StockSprout restock planner. If the planner skips a vending route, it's almost always stale telemetry from the cabinet sensors — the planner quietly drops machines it hasn't heard from in 6 hours. Don't restart the whole scheduler; just requeue the affected route from the admin panel and the next cycle picks it up. Steps with screenshots, plus the sensor-staleness override flag, are documented on the page below.

operations page: https://jenkins.zemvarcloud.local/job/merge_requests/repo/build/73930b4b30f0a8ed